I think it is worth noting in the bestiary entry on Night-gazer Khighorahk that once he has spawned his weaker form the Light Pillars no longer go out. So after killing his first form, a player no longer needs to worry about relighting.

I noticed while fighting Stomp that the rocks he throws at you with his left hand, that hit through your prayer (Protect from Ranged cuts the damage in half however) are also responsible for destroying the debris that fell from the ceiling. These rocks can also be dodged (by running a couple steps to the side) to avoid the damage and have them carry on destroying boulders behind you. Even if you do not dodge them, they will still destroy nearby boulders.

 

Rocks thrown slowly from left hand:

-Always hit for the same amount of damage (might vary based on bosses level though)

-Hit through Prayer; Protect from Ranged cuts damage in half (damage went from 247 to 123 against level 104 Stomp)

-Can be dodged by sidestepping a couple steps

-Will destroy some fallen debris whether they hit you or you dodge them

Here are some drops missing from some of the bosses (note: these all appear in front of the dungeon's ending ladder.):

 

Gluttonous Behemoth: drops Behemoth notes (part 1)

 

Plane-freezer Lakhrahnaz: drops Stalker notes (part 1)

 

To'Kash the Bloodchiller: drops Kal'gerion notes (part 1)

 

Bulwark Beast: drops Behemoth notes (part 2)

 

Skeletal Horde: drops Divine skinweaver's journal

 

Hobgoblin Geomancer: drops Hobgoblin scrawlings

 

Unholy Cursebearer: drops The price of betrayal

 

Rammernaut: drops Equipment requisition receipts

 

Lexicus Runewright: drops Lexicus runewright's journal

 

Sagittare: drops Ammunition requisition orders

 

Night-gazer Khighorahk: drops Stalker notes (part 2)

 

Shadow-forger Ihlakhizan: drops Stalker notes (part 3)
